Browsing General 41 - 60 of 8230 results
- View Details
£3.05 GBP
- View Details
£3.05 GBP
- View Details
£3.05 GBP
- View Details
£3.05 GBP
- View Details
Starting at:£2.92 GBP
- View Details
£5.58 GBP
- View Details
£7.46 GBP
- View Details
£2.29 GBP
- View Details
£3.81 GBP
- View Details
£3.05 GBP
- View Details
£2.29 GBP
- View Details
£3.05 GBP
- View Details
£3.05 GBP
- View Details
£4.78 GBP
- View Details
Starting at:£3.80 GBP
- View Details
£3.05 GBP
- View Details
£7.46 GBP
- View Details
£7.46 GBP
- View Details
£3.05 GBP
- View Details
£7.46 GBP